| Current Fire Information: 4:15 pm, 
        Saturday, June 29: The Cow Camp Fire is reported burning at this time 
        on the Pinedale Ranger District near Wolf Lake east of Boulder. Size is 
        reported at approximately 15+ acres through visual aerial inspection from 
        the helicopter with rate of spread increasing as the fire crowns and spots 
        in heavy timber. Winds are estimated at between 10-15 mph in the area.

        to report fires: Callers are reminded that if they are using a cell phone, they may not get a local office when they dial 911. The best place to call for area fires is either the local Sheriff's office or the Bridger-Teton Fire Office. Be prepared to give a location of the smoke, your name, where you are calling from, and how they can get ahold of you again for more information if needed. | 
| Anyone with concerns about fires can contact the Sublette County Sheriff's office at 307-367-4376, or the Pinedale Ranger District, 307-367-4326. Hikers in the wilderness who have cell phones (and can get a signal out) can call 911 and ask to be routed to the Sublette County Sheriff's office if they need to report a fire or have concerns. Be aware that 911 may route you to a different area other than Pinedale depending on where you are calling from. |
